if log 2 = 0.3010 find the number of digits in 4^29

 Given \: log 2 = 0.3010 \: --(1)

 Now , Find \: log \: 4^{29} \\= log \: (2^{2})^{29} \\= log \: 2^{2\times 29} \\= log \: 2^{58} \\= 58  log 2 \\= 58 \times 0.3010 \: [from \: (1) ]

 = 17. 458

 log \: 4^{29} = 17.458

 \red { Number \:of \:digits \: in \: 4^{29}} \\= one \: more \: than \: characteristic \\ of \: log \: 4^{29}\\= 17 + 1 \\= 18

Therefore.,

 \red { Number \:of \:digits \: in \: 4^{29}} \green {= 18}
